How To Fix NSDM_MM_MIG105 - Warning MSEG &1 &2 &3: KALNR could not be determined


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: NSDM_MM_MIG - MM-IM: Messages for Migration

  • Message number: 105

  • Message text: Warning MSEG &1 &2 &3: KALNR could not be determined
